But what we do see of the rangers post Marcus is quite worrying - Garibaldi uses them to beat up Lise's kidnappers on Mars in Rising Star before Mars has joined the alliance, and they turn horribly vigilante in Learning curve, which has to be the most morally corrupt episode of b5 ever, in my book. They're only accountable to a single leader, specist and unrepresentative of the member races, and they steamroll over local authority when it suits them. When the White Star fleet invades earth space in Rising Star the message seems to be *submit to our authority or face annihilation*.
Granted, that's a very biased view of them based on 2 or 3 episodes, but i'm still not fully convinced that a series focusing on our ranger heroes will necessarily be a good thing - unless it shows us a new side to their character.
